Transaction 75803dfb68cb1691390c5a97974ad8966ebc831f98ea9f6bca7eb3766402e113
1 Input
1 Output
-
75803dfb68cb1691390c5a97974ad8966ebc831f98ea9f6bca7eb3766402e113:0
- value
- 41325561
- script pubkey
- OP_0 OP_PUSHBYTES_20 35da7306504d31784e775e39d195833ec545f164
- address
- ltc1qxhd8xpjsf5chsnnhtcuar9vr8mz5tutygxy4sf